ConnectOne Bancorp (NASDAQ:CNOB) and MVB Financial (NASDAQ:MVBF) are both small-cap finance companies, but which is the better stock? We will contrast the two businesses based on the strength of their media sentiment, valuation, community ranking, dividends, institutional ownership, profitability, analyst recommendations, earnings and risk.

67.7% of ConnectOne Bancorp shares are held by institutional investors. Comparatively, 52.7% of MVB Financial shares are held by institutional investors. 6.4% of ConnectOne Bancorp shares are held by insiders. Comparatively, 11.1% of MVB Financial shares are held by ins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that hedge funds, large money managers and endowments believe a company will outperform the market over the long term.

ConnectOne Bancorp has a net margin of 13.80% compared to MVB Financial's net margin of 8.78%. ConnectOne Bancorp's return on equity of 6.77% beat MVB Financial's return on equity.

ConnectOne Bancorp has a beta of 1.3, indicating that its stock price is 30% more vol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, MVB Financial has a beta of 1.04, indicating that its stock price is 4% more volatile than the S&P 500.

ConnectOne Bancorp pays an annual dividend of $0.72 per share and has a dividend yield of 2.9%. MVB Financial pays an annual dividend of $0.68 per share and has a dividend yield of 3.6%. ConnectOne Bancorp pays out 40.7% of its earnings in the form of a dividend. MVB Financial pays out 44.4% of its earnings in the form of a dividend. Both companies have healthy payout ratios and should be able to cover their dividend payments with earnings for the next several years.
